Former Freshmen winning artist Christina K. talks about her love for NYC, and offers up some great advice about life in this week’s Hot Seat.
1. Tell us about your craziest touring experience.
Christina K. I was doing a show in Arizona last year, and missed my flight back to the city. I had checked out of the hotel, couldn’t get in touch with the promoter and was pretty much without shelter or transportation. Luckily, I made some friends pretty quickly.
2. What type of college class would you’d most want to take and why?
Christina K.: I would love to take a Psychology class. You meet so many different people and deal with so many personalities doing music, having that extra insight about why we do the things we do is a definite plus. A few mind control and brainwashing tactics could probably be useful too…lol
3. What city in America is the most fun to visit and why?
Christina K.: New York is my #1. Of course the weather isn’t as nice as Miami or LA, but the energy is unmatched. Its so inspiring to see so many unique individuals all in one place. From clubs, restaurants, shops and galleries… There is just so many different things to do… You can party at about 5 or 6 spots in one night and it all flows so smooth and seems to be never ending.
